Toni Juhana Wirtanen (born April 4, 1975, Heinola, Finland) is a Finnish musician, best known as the vocalist, guitarist and songwriter for the rock band Apulanta.[1]

Wirtanen is also known for having written numerous songs for the Finnish pop singer Irina, and appeared in the 1999 movie Pitkä kuuma kesä, portraying the lead-singer of the school band The Vittupäät.[2]

Discography

Charting hits featured in
  • 2003: "Dynamite" (Beats And Styles featuring Toni W & B.O. Dubb) (Peaked in FIN: #2)
  • 2003: "Asvaltti" (Toni Wirtanen, Infekto, Leijonanmieli, Paarma, Nopsajalka, Bommitommi) (Peaked in FIN: #8)
  • 2014: "Hätähuuto" (Brädi feat. Toni Wirtanen) (Peaked in FIN: #3)
  • 2014: "Sata kesää, tuhat yötä" (Vain elämää, season 3, Paula Koivuniemi Day) (Peaked in FIN: #12)
